What are the main signs that indicate I need emergency rodent control in Chino?

You should consider emergency rodent control if you hear persistent scurrying or gnawing sounds within your walls or attic, especially at night. Other common signs include the discovery of rodent droppings (small, dark, pellet-like feces) in kitchens, pantries, or hidden areas, distinctive musty odors, visible signs of chewing on wires, food packaging, or wooden structures, and grease marks along baseboards or walls where rodents frequently travel. Seeing live rodents also necessitates immediate action.

What rats and mice destroy in Chino homes

Left unchecked, rats and mice cause real, costly damage in Chino homes: they gnaw constantly to wear down their teeth, and chewed electrical wiring is a leading, under-recognized cause of house fires. They shred insulation and stored belongings for nesting, gnaw through drywall, pipes, and even softer structural wood, and foul attics, wall voids, and pantries with urine and droppings that soak into insulation and subfloor. What starts as a few droppings can end in rewiring and insulation replacement — which is why removal and permanent exclusion beat one-off trapping.

Chino rodent warning signs

Telltale signs of rats and mice in Chino homes: fresh droppings along baseboards and near food, gnaw marks on wood, wiring, and packaging, dark grease rub-marks where they travel walls, scratching or scurrying inside walls and ceilings at night, shredded-paper or insulation nests, and a lingering musky ammonia smell. You will often hear or smell them before you see one.

How Emergency Rodent Control works in Chino

Effective Emergency Rodent Control in Chino works in a set order: a full inspection to map entry points and nesting sites, exclusion first — sealing every gap wider than a quarter inch around pipes, vents, and the foundation — then trapping and removal of the active population, followed by clean-out and disinfection of nesting material and droppings to erase the scent trails that draw new rodents back. For an active, urgent infestation, same-day response limits the contamination and damage while the work is scheduled.

Why rodents are a health hazard in Chino

The health stakes are real: rats and mice spread hantavirus, salmonella, and leptospirosis through droppings and urine, their waste triggers asthma and allergies, and they carry fleas and ticks indoors. Cleanup of heavily soiled areas should be done with proper protection, not a household vacuum that can aerosolize contaminants.

Is exclusion worth it in Chino?

Yes — trapping alone only removes the rodents present now. Permanent exclusion (sealing every gap around pipes, vents, and the foundation) is what stops new rats and mice from re-entering, which is why it is the core of lasting control in Chino.

Is my Chino landlord responsible for rodents?

Structural gaps — foundation cracks, unscreened vents, worn door sweeps — are building-maintenance issues, so California habitability law almost always makes the landlord responsible for sealing entry points and arranging removal when the tenant did not cause the problem. Put every notice in writing.
